M237 TRJ is a 2000 Toyota RAV4 in Green with a 2,000c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.7%.
Across all 2000 Toyota RAV4 models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.9% with a typical mileage of 84,513 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Toyota RAV4 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 26,391 recorded failures. If you're considering buying M237 TRJ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ota RAV4 typically stays on UK roads for around 32 years. At 26 years old, this Toyota RAV4 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
